Understanding the Locking Welded Hydraulic Cylinders

Locking welded hydraulic cylinders are an essential component in hydraulic systems, providing stability and safety during operations. These cylinders feature a specific locking device that can maintain loads without pressure, ensuring operator safety and simplifying operation.

Design and Construction Characteristics

  • Locking Mechanism – Safety: Utilizes a specific locking device for load maintenance without pressure, enhancing safety and simplifying operation.
  • Durable Materials – High-Strength Steel: Constructed with high-strength steel for enhanced durability and compression resistance.
  • Anti-Corrosion Coating: Features an anti-corrosion coating for longevity in harsh environments.
  • Compact Design – Space Saving: Designed for applications with limited space, offering versatility in various equipment.
